+\begin{frame}{802.11r}
+ \begin{itemize}
+ \item Extension to 802.11i (WPA2)
+ \item Allows AP switching in cooperation between both APs
+ \item Supplicant negotiates keys before AP switch
+ \item Usable when moving between access points
+ \item Only in same mobility domain
+ \item Communication between APs can be either over air or DS
+ \end{itemize}
+\end{frame}
+
+\begin{frame}{802.11r terminology}
+ \begin{itemize}
+ \item \textbf{R0KH} Derives keys for all R1KM in network
+ \item \textbf{R1KH} Derives PTK (Pairwise transient key)
+ \item \textbf{S0KH} in Supplicant derives R0 keys
+ \item \textbf{S1KH} in Supplicant derives with R1KH PTK
+ \end{itemize}
+ Both R0KH and R1KH communicate with authenticator
+
+ Another point: 802.11r (FT) is advertised
+\end{frame}

+\begin{frame}[fragile]{Setting it up (on OpenWRT)}
+ \begin{verbatim}
+option ieee80211r '1'
+option nasid '11'
+option r1_key_holder '04F021242480'
+list r0kh '04:F0:21:24:24:80,11,E1594C87BF2C30DA27E1C116C5683B90'
+list r0kh '04:F0:21:24:24:5E,12,903F4FFCC7907A6562B665B6721D5E1F'
+list r1kh '04:F0:21:24:24:80,04:F0:21:24:24:80,290856554F810E3D3D5C06DC5F82639E'
+list r1kh '04:F0:21:24:24:5E,04:F0:21:24:24:5E,F38D019B98BA8C8B559ED52A456083CC'
+ \end{verbatim}
+ \vspace{1cm}
+ \begin{verbatim}
+list r0kh 'BSSID,NASID,KEY'
+list r1kh 'BSSID,KEYHOLDER-ID,KEY'
+ \end{verbatim}
+\end{frame}
+
+\begin{frame}{Measurements}
+ \begin{itemize}
+ \item Two 5GHz APs with OpenWRT and configured 802.11r (hostapd, ath10k)
+ \item PC running iperf3 server
+ \item Laptop with wpa\_supplicant running iperf3 client in UDP mode
+ \item iperf3 configured for 600Mbits/sec
+ \end{itemize}
+\end{frame}

+\begin{frame}[fragile]{Real usability}
+ \begin{itemize}
+ \item \textbf{Android} Lowers threshold for switch
+ \item \textbf{Linux(wpa\_supplicant)} No effect (well..)
+ \end{itemize}
+
+ \begin{verbatim}
+ # mode:short scan:threshold:long scan
+ bgscan="simple:5:-50:300"
+ \end{verbatim}
+\end{frame}
